Adaptogenic herbs can be a game-changer for dogs experiencing stress, anxiety, or immune challenges. These natural botanicals help regulate the body’s response to stress, promoting balance and resilience. Whether your dog struggles with separation anxiety, aging-related stress, or general nervousness, adaptogens can provide essential support. Here are six powerful adaptogenic herbs that can help your dog thrive under stress.
Ashwagandha

Ashwagandha is one of the most well-known adaptogenic herbs, prized for its ability to reduce cortisol levels and promote relaxation. This ancient Ayurvedic herb can help dogs who experience anxiety, hyperactivity, or restlessness. It also supports brain function and immune health, making it a valuable addition to your dog’s wellness regimen.
Reishi Mushroom

Reishi mushroom is a powerful adaptogen known for its calming effects and immune-boosting properties. It helps regulate stress responses and may reduce inflammation, making it beneficial for aging dogs or those with chronic stress. Turkey Tail mushroom is an excellent adaptogen for dogs, particularly for immune support. It helps regulate stress hormones and is often used to support dogs dealing with environmental stressors or recovery from illness. Holy Basil (Tulsi)

Holy basil, also known as Tulsi, is a potent adaptogen that helps reduce anxiety and supports adrenal function. It works by balancing cortisol levels and promoting a sense of calm in dogs that are easily startled or anxious. Tulsi also contains antioxidants that contribute to overall health.
Rhodiola Rosea

Rhodiola Rosea is a fantastic adaptogen that improves energy levels and helps the body adapt to physical and emotional stress. It is particularly beneficial for working dogs, senior dogs, or those recovering from illness. Rhodiola can improve endurance, reduce fatigue, and support cognitive function, making it an excellent herb for active and aging pets alike.
Turmeric

Turmeric is a natural adaptogen that provides anti-inflammatory and stress-reducing benefits. It is particularly useful for dogs experiencing joint discomfort or chronic stress.
